Horseradish ‘Wasabi’ Horseradish can stand in for wasabi root. Mix 2 teaspoons freshly grated horseradish with 1 teaspoon of mustard, a few drops of soy sauce, and 1 chopped anchovy. Use this in place of the wasabi paste.

Web19 okt. 2024 · Here is a step-by-step guide on how to clean horse radish roots: 1. Rinse the roots under cold water. This will help to remove any dirt or debris that is on the surface of the roots. 2. Use a brush to scrub the roots. This will help to remove any remaining dirt or debris. 3. Peel the roots.

WebDo work in a well-ventilated area when you are preparing fresh horseradish. Peel the roots with a vegetable peeler and use a blender or food processor along (with a small amount of water) to handle the grating. Here’s what the experts have to say about the health benefits of horseradish: minimum body fat for pregnancyWebAlternatively, you can preserve the grated root in vinegar, and then use this prepared horseradish for soups or sauces. All you do is peel the roots and then grate them into white wine vinegar. Don’t use cider vinegar because it tends to make the horseradish turn brown very quickly. most trending candy right nowWeb20 mei 2016 · Thank you Meghan, I have 50 lbs, well 49 and a half lbs. now of fresh horseradish roots~we added some to our sandwiches at lunch today.
